Ist Python eine gute Alternative zu PHP?
Erfahre, ob Python eine sinnvolle Alternative zu PHP ist - Vergleich von Performance, Frameworks, Kosten und Anwendungsfällen für Web‑Entwicklung.
Wenn du nach einem PHP Ersatz, einer zeitgemäßen Alternative zu PHP für die Backend‑Programmierung. Auch bekannt als PHP Alternative, die die aktuelle Web‑Landschaft prägt, bist du hier genau richtig. PHP Ersatz bedeutet nicht einfach nur „etwas Neues“, sondern ein Set aus Technologien, die Performance, Wartbarkeit und Community‑Support besser auf heutige Anforderungen abstimmen.
Ein verbreiteter Kandidat ist Node.js, eine JavaScript‑Laufzeitumgebung, die serverseitiges Coding mit Event‑Loop‑Modell ermöglicht. Sie nutzt das gleiche Ökosystem wie Frontend‑JavaScript, wodurch Entwickler schnell zwischen Front‑ und Backend wechseln können. Python, eine interpretierte Sprache, die durch lesbare Syntax und riesige Bibliotheken besticht, wird häufig für Web‑Frameworks wie Django oder Flask eingesetzt und bietet starke Unterstützung für Datenanalyse und KI. WebAssembly, ein binäres Format, das nahezu native Performance im Browser liefert, erlaubt es, Sprachen wie Rust oder C++ in Web‑Umgebungen zu bringen und eröffnet neue Wege für rechenintensive Backend‑Logik. Schließlich ist Rust, eine systemnahe Sprache mit Fokus auf Speicher‑Sicherheit und Geschwindigkeit, ein starker Anwärter für Micro‑Services, die höchste Effizienz verlangen.
Die Wahl des richtigen PHP Ersatz hängt von drei Kernfaktoren ab: Performance, Entwickler‑Erfahrung und Ökosystem. Performance‑Messungen zeigen, dass Node.js bei I/O‑intensiven Aufgaben oft besser abschneidet, während Rust bei CPU‑schweren Berechnungen Spitzenwerte liefert. Die Lernkurve ist ein zweiter Punkt – Python punktet mit einem niedrigen Einstieg, ideal für Teams, die schnell produktiv werden wollen. Das Ökosystem schließt Hosting‑Optionen, verfügbare Pakete und Community‑Support ein; hier punktet Node.js mit einer riesigen Anzahl an npm‑Modulen, Python mit Pip‑Bibliotheken und Rust mit einem wachsenden Cargo‑Store.
Ein weiterer Aspekt ist die Zukunftsfähigkeit. WebAssembly gewinnt an Bedeutung, weil es es ermöglicht, bereits kompilierte Code‑Bases in jedem modernen Browser auszuführen, wodurch serverseitige Logik näher an den Nutzer rücken kann. Gleichzeitig bleibt Node.js relevant, weil es das volle JavaScript‑Erlebnis vom Client bis zum Server liefert – ein klarer Vorteil für Full‑Stack‑Entwickler. Python hält durch seine Dominanz im Bereich Data Science und Machine Learning seine Position, während Rust zunehmend in Cloud‑ und Edge‑Umgebungen eingesetzt wird, wo Sicherheit und Geschwindigkeit entscheidend sind.
Im Kontext von PHP Ersatz solltest du außerdem prüfen, wie leicht bestehende PHP‑Projekte migriert werden können. Viele Frameworks bieten Brücken zu Node.js (z. B. Express mit PHP‑Routen) oder zu Python (z. B. Flask‑Templates, die PHP‑Syntax nachahmen). Für stark typisierte Code‑Bases kann WebAssembly als Zwischenschicht dienen, indem du kritische Module aus Rust oder C++ exportierst, ohne das gesamte System neu zu schreiben. Diese Strategien ermöglichen schrittweise Modernisierung, ohne den Betrieb komplett zu stoppen.
Die nachfolgenden Artikel zeigen dir praxisnahe Beispiele: Warum PHP 2025 nicht veraltet ist, wann PHP die bessere Wahl bleibt, und wie du konkret Node.js, Python oder Rust als Ersatz einsetzen kannst. Du erfährst, welche Tools du brauchst, welche Performance‑Benchmarks zu erwarten sind und wie du deine Entscheidung an das Projekt‑Budget anpasst. Schau dir die einzelnen Beiträge an, um gezielt tief in die jeweiligen Alternativen einzutauchen und den passenden PHP Ersatz für deine Anwendung zu finden.
Erfahre, ob Python eine sinnvolle Alternative zu PHP ist - Vergleich von Performance, Frameworks, Kosten und Anwendungsfällen für Web‑Entwicklung.